DISCONNECT THE BATTERY for a few minutes....
it'ts not the 02 sensors... but more likely the maf.... OR a boost leak...
diconnect the maf by unplugging it... u simply press the tab on the right side and pull it up... the cel will come on and stay on thats OK... if the car can boost past .4 bars then its more likely the maf... just dont get crazy on the gas...
there are a few other things you can do like pressure testing.... but before that you should pull on the black hoses coming form the Y pipe to the ICs and the ones under the car form the ICs to the turbos... see if one of them gave out....
